监控 Amazon DocumentDB 集群状态
集群的状态表示集群的运行状况。您可以使用 Amazon DocumentDB 控制台或 AWS CLI describe-db-clusters
命令查看集群的状态。
集群状态值
下表列出集群状态的有效值。
集群 状态 | 描述 |
---|---|
available | 集群状态良好且可用。 |
backing-up | 当前正在备份集群。 |
creating | 正在创建集群。正在创建的过程中无法访问。 |
deleting | 正在删除集群。正在删除的过程中无法访问。 |
failing-over | 正在执行从主实例到 Amazon DocumentDB 副本的故障转移。 |
inaccessible-encryption-credentials | 无法访问用于加密或解密集群的 AWS KMS 密钥。 |
maintenance | 正在对集群应用维护更新。此状态用于 Amazon DocumentDB 预先计划的集群级别的维护。 |
migrating | 正将集群快照还原给集群。 |
migration-failed | 迁移失败。 |
modifying | 正在按照客户请求修改集群。 |
renaming | 正在按照客户请求重命名集群。 |
resetting-master-credentials | 正在按照客户请求重置集群的主凭证。 |
upgrading | 集群引擎版本正在升级。 |
使用监控集群状态AWS 管理控制台
在使用AWS 管理控制台确定集群状态时,请使用以下过程。
通过以下网址登录 AWS 管理控制台并打开 Amazon DocumentDB 控制台:https://console.aws.amazon.com/docdb。
在导航窗格中,选择 Clusters.
在“Clusters (集群)”导航窗格中,您将看到 Cluster identifier (集群标识符) 列。您的实例将在集群下列出,与以下屏幕截图类似。
![
带显示活动状态的示例集群的集群页屏幕截图。
](/projects/DocumentDB-20201111-zh/14a352fea6ebf7c1ed6cea6024aba1ce.png)
在 Cluster identifier (集群标识符) 列中,找到您感兴趣的实例名称。然后,要查找实例的状态,请跨该行阅读至 Status (状态) 列,如下所示。
![
带显示活动状态的示例集群的集群页屏幕截图。
](/projects/DocumentDB-20201111-zh/ff92edff28d6c54ab497bbefb23fdfd3.png)
使用监控集群状态AWS CLI
在使用 AWS CLI 确定集群的状态时,请使用 describe-db-clusters
操作。以下代码可查找集群 的状态。sample-cluster
.
对于 Linux、macOS 或 Unix:
aws docdb describe-db-clusters \
--db-cluster-identifier sample-cluster \
--query 'DBClusters[*].[DBClusterIdentifier,Status]'
对于 Windows:
aws docdb describe-db-clusters ^
--db-cluster-identifier sample-cluster ^
--query 'DBClusters[*].[DBClusterIdentifier,Status]'
此操作的输出将类似于下文。
[
[
"sample-cluster",
"available"
]
]